WebApr 6, 2024 · Tuberculosis. Tuberculosis (TB) is a contagious disease caused by infection with Mycobacterium tuberculosis ( Mtb) bacteria. It is spread through the air when a person with TB disease of the lungs or throat coughs, speaks or sings, and people nearby breathe in these bacteria and become infected. Climate change is a global public health challenge. The changes in climatic factors affect the pattern and burden of tuberculosis, which is a worldwide public health problem affecting low and middle-income countries.
